According to new information, Google is offering the RCS code to Apple as a new year’s gift and asking the company to adopt this Rich Communication Services (RCS) code which is a widely used messaging service instead of using iMessage.

Google came to his Twitter account and says Happy New Year, Apple, and further stated that iOS users are extremely deserving to adventure a modern texting experience just like all Android users experiencing with Rich Communication Services, not with the iMessage. 

The Twitter post further offers the RCS Code for Apple as a little CES gift from Android and also forces Apple to start upgrading to RCS. Notably, Google has also run a GetTheMessage campaign to compel Apple to adopt the RCS messaging standard but the Apple is happy with iMessage as of now.
